Capacity note for the Brindlehurst PDF invoice renderer, shared for security review. Peak load arrives at month-end close: roughly triple the daily average. Each render is sandboxed, and font cache eviction bounds memory per worker. We sized the pool so a malicious oversized document cannot starve neighbors; untrusted input never raises the page limit. The enforced rendering constants appear directly below.

tuning table, yajog-yahof:
BUDGETS = {
    "lamvan": 303,
    "wenox": 460,
    "fenvan": 525,
}

## Releases

The Stallhaven occupancy feed ships as a versioned tarball every other Thursday. Each release bundles the sensor poller, the deck-level aggregator, and the public API stub used by the Garrowby Transit dashboard. New team members should pull the latest tag rather than main, since main often carries unverified calibration tables. Releases are signed before upload, and the verifier refuses unsigned feeds at the gate controllers. All artifacts must be verified against the release signing key below.

rollout seal: bky4_x7Gc

Subject: CSV Import Wizard — plugin hook changes in Fernwheel 4.2

Hi all,

The CSV import wizard in Fernwheel 4.2 now validates column mappings before invoking plugin transformers. If your plugin registers a pre-import hook, it will receive a normalized header array instead of raw strings. Delimiter sniffing has also moved ahead of the hook chain, so you no longer need your own detection logic. Please retest against the staging wizard before Friday. The build you should pin your test harness to is listed below.

trace token, fafog-kageg: htk4_98e6

Present: R. Callister (chair), F. Odume, L. Branwick, S. Teroux.

The committee reviewed headcount figures for Northvale Division, which is 9% over its approved staffing plan. A freeze on all external hires was agreed, effective immediately, with exceptions requiring sign-off from R. Callister. Internal transfers remain permitted. F. Odume will brief team leads this week and prepare a board summary for the next cycle. The rationale tied to our forward plans is recorded below for the board's reference.

management briefing: The renewal with Zoraelax Group closes at $10 million a year, 15 percent below the last contract. Project Ralael slips by six weeks because of the audit delay.